Alpha Airports rebuilds its executive team
Alpha Airports, which had its shares temporarily suspended from the London Stock Exchange early this year, has made two senior appointments as it looks to rebuild its executive team.
Mark Adams, previously chief financial officer for STA Travel Group, has joined the company as finance director, assuming responsibilities from interim finance director Tim Redburn.
Andrew Magowan, who will join the company on 20 November as secretary and general council, has worked as a senior lawyer for Associated British Food since 2003, as well as for city law firm Berwin Leighton Paisner.
Alpha had its shares suspended from the London Stock Exchange in April over accounting uncertainties to do with a deal with Icelandic charter airline Excel Airways. They were readmitted in July.
The subsequent fall-out saw chief executive Kevin Abbott and finance director Heather McRae quit, and chairman Graham Frost step down.
